Riku Molander
Finland
Riku Molander is a Finnish professional poker player primarily known for high-stakes cash games and his aggressive, technically sound style. Despite limited public tournament records, his reputation in the poker community is built on deep strategic understanding and consistent online performance.
Overview
Riku Molander is a professional poker player from Finland, recognized in the poker community for his involvement in high-stakes cash games and aggressive playing style. While his live tournament results are sparse, he has built a reputation through online high-stakes play and strategic discussions.
Early Life and Chess Background
Born on April 1, 1979, Molander also holds the title of FIDE Master (FM) in chess, with a peak Elo rating of 2353. His chess career, spanning the late 1990s and early 2000s, reflects strong analytical skills that likely contribute to his poker prowess.
Playing Style
According to community discussions, Molander is known for an aggressive approach, frequently applying pressure and maintaining balanced ranges. His style is suited to high-volatility environments, relying on precise reads and range construction.
Tournament Record
Public tournament results for Riku Molander are extremely limited. A result from the USOP Japan 2025 Osaka event (5,000 JPY buy-in, 10th place out of 761 entries) may belong to a different player with the same first name. Finnish poker players with similar surnames, such as Riku Koivurinne (over $67,000 in live earnings) and Miika Molander (online cashes), share a nationality but are distinct individuals.
